Choosing the Right Platform
One of the first steps in making money online designing logos is to choose the right platform. There are several popular websites where you can showcase your talent and connect with potential clients. Here are a few to consider:
Platform | Description |
---|---|
Upwork | Upwork is a global freelancing platform that connects freelancers with clients seeking various services, including logo design. |
Freelancer | Freelancer is another popular freelancing platform where you can bid on logo design projects and compete with other designers. |
99designs | 99designs is a design crowdsourcing platform where clients post design contests, and designers submit their logo designs for review. |
Behance | Behance is a creative portfolio website where you can showcase your logo design work and attract potential clients. |
Building Your Portfolio
A strong portfolio is crucial for attracting clients and showcasing your design skills. Here are some tips for building an impressive portfolio:
- Include a variety of logo designs, showcasing your versatility.
- Highlight your best work, focusing on logos that have received positive feedback or have been successfully implemented.
- Provide context for each design, explaining the design process and the client’s goals.
- Keep your portfolio up-to-date with your latest work.

Setting Your Rates
Deciding on your rates is an important step in making money online designing logos. Here are some factors to consider when setting your rates:
- Your experience and skill level: More experienced designers can charge higher rates.
- The complexity of the project: Logos with more intricate designs or multiple revisions may require higher rates.
- The client’s budget: Be aware of the client’s budget and adjust your rates accordingly.
